Sounds like CA will no longer permit CRV and non-CRV glass to be mixed together, so all of the little recycling places around the grocery stores in our area no longer accept wine bottles since wine bottles are non-CRV. Setting aside the "logic" of the whole state recycling structure, the result is that wine and spirits bottles are considered scrap.
From a little research, it appears that there is little value in scrap glass - if you can find someone to even take your scrap glass. I'm not enamored of driving all around LA begging someone to take my empty wine bottles and our community doesn't do recycling pick up with your trash.
Seems like a bad result to toss them in the landfill, but there also appears to be absolutely no real demand for recycled glass outside of the CRV program.
